In a major boost for the New York Giants, star wide receiver Malik Nabers has been declared ready to compete in the upcoming Week 1 matchups. After much speculation regarding his conditioning and readiness, the news confirms that the dynamic playmaker will be on the field to lead the team's offensive charge.

Nabers has quickly become a focal point of the franchise's future. His ability to create separation and his explosive route running make him a nightmare for opposing defensive coordinators. With his participation secured, the Giants can now finalize their deep-ball strategies and rely on his ability to convert crucial third downs.
